Unveiling the Remarkable Health Benefits of Cabbage

Cabbage, often overlooked by Kenyans, is a versatile and nutritious vegetable that packs a powerful punch when it comes to health benefits.

This cruciferous veggie, available in various colors like green, red, and purple, is not only delicious but also offers a plethora of advantages for your well-being.

1. Rich in Nutrients: Despite its humble appearance, cabbage is a nutritional powerhouse. It contains essential vitamins like vitamin C, K, and B6, along with minerals such as manganese, calcium, potassium, and magnesium, contributing to overall health and vitality.

2. Antioxidant Properties: Loaded with antioxidants like polyphenols and sulfur compounds, cabbage aids in combating harmful free radicals in the body, reducing the risk of chronic diseases and supporting a healthy immune system.

3. Potential Cancer-Fighting Abilities: Studies suggest that the compounds found in cabbage, like sulforaphane and indole-3-carbinol, may help in inhibiting the growth of cancer cells, particularly in breast, colon, and prostate cancers.

4. Digestive Health: With a significant amount of fiber, cabbage promotes healthy digestion by preventing constipation and supporting a thriving gut microbiome, contributing to better overall digestive health.

5. Heart Health: Regular consumption of cabbage has been associated with a reduced risk of cardiovascular diseases. Its high content of polyphenols and fiber helps in lowering cholesterol levels and supporting healthy blood pressure.

6. Weight Management: Low in calories and high in fiber, cabbage is a fantastic addition to a weight-loss diet. It helps in keeping you full for longer periods while providing essential nutrients.

7. Skin and Hair Health: The vitamins and antioxidants present in cabbage contribute to healthier skin by promoting collagen production and protecting against skin damage. Additionally, it aids in maintaining lustrous hair.
